TV Actress Tops The Show

There are several kinds of shows on the televisions which have different kinds of requirements. For actresses, they can be required for a series, a daily soap, or a part that is to be played constantly in a reality show for an entertainment factor. All the female performers on the screen are the actresses. Actors can have lead roles or can be supporting the leads; they might even just have a minor role wherein they come on the screen for a very short span of time.

Actresses essentially read scripts, and once they agree to be a part of the project, they sign. The dates for shooting for a television show is important since generally, the number of shooting days required for a television show is more than that for a feature film. The roles are given to them in such a way that the actresses look like the characters that they play and are accepted by the audience. Actresses need to stay fit and shape their bodies according to their on-screen characters. According to the script, they might as well have the need to travel to certain places or learn some art form or language.

They are well versed with the script and know the importance of each character in the project that they are working in. At the casting phase, they might as well appear for some auditions or screen tests in front of the casting team and the director. The director is the person with whom the she interact the most. While some filmmakers give their actresses complete freedom to act the way they wish to and deviate from the script a little bit, certain directors like it if the actors stick to the script strictly. The actors also need to go through the styling phase- the costumes, make-up, hair and the like, which more or less remains constant for one television show. They need to coordinate with the cameramen for every take that is shot and also work well with the make-up artists (even between the takes).
